Why Traditional Cold Storage Falls Short
Standard refrigeration units frequently suffer from "thermal fatigue," where internal temperatures vary due to regular door openings or poor insulation. This disparity leads to:
- Rapid bacterial development: Fluctuating temperature levels develop a breeding ground for bacteria.
- Energy wastage: Constant power cycling puts pressure on the grid and pumps up utility costs.
- Food deterioration: Improper humidity control leads to premature putridity, contributing to the international food waste crisis.

One-third of all food produced for human intake is lost or wasted internationally. This represents not only a massive economic loss but a considerable ecological problem-- squandered food produces methane in garbage dumps and wastes the water and energy used to produce it.
